Aesthetic Territory Sales Manager - Miami
Location: Must be based in Miami, FL
Work Model: Remote; Must be able to regularly travel within assigned territory (Southern Flordia) and occasionally outside of the assigned territory
Summary
Our client is seeking an Aesthetic Territory Sales Manager to join their team! In this role, you will represent advanced laser solutions within the medical aesthetic field, focusing on developing strong relationships with clinics and med spas. You'll be able to support cutting-edge products, earn competitive compensation, and grow your career by consistently studying industry trends and best practices.
Responsibilities
- Conduct high-volume outreach, including cold calls, to potential medical and aesthetic practices
- Show professionalism, clear communication, and strong organizational skills to build trust with customers
- Identify decision-makers and evaluate their purchasing processes
- Pinpoint each prospect's goals and challenges to offer suitable laser solutions
- Uphold our client's values with integrity and professionalism
- Pursue new business through prospecting, trade show attendance, virtual demonstrations, and in-person meetings
- Remain knowledgeable about the latest products, services, and industry updates
- Demonstrate a consistent work ethic and maintain thorough records of sales activities
- Travel within the assigned region, as well as attend trade shows, training sessions, and other industry events
- Adapt to flexible scheduling, including occasional evenings and weekends
Requirements
- 4 years experience in outbound healthcare business-to-business sales experience
- Experience selling Capital Equipment, Durable Medical Equipment, and/or Medical Devices is required
- Must have a network and knowledge of the aesthetics industry and the key industry leaders within the market
- Proven ability to generate leads, schedule quality appointments, and maintain a sales pipeline
- Familiarity with general sales and marketing strategies
- Strong phone, written, and in-person communication skills
- Passion for prospecting and establishing new client relationships
- Competence in MS Office Suite and basic internet research
- Experience working with CRM platforms
- Self-driven approach with a reliable work ethic and accountability
- Ability to drive within the territory daily
- Willingness to travel overnight (up to 30%) for events and trade shows
- Flexibility to work some evenings and weekends as needed
- Capability to lift and carry up to 50 lbs occasionally, as well as push or pull heavier equipment on wheels
- Physical capacity to stand, bend, squat, reach, twist, drive, and sit for extended periods
